Distributed Systems Auditability

Architecture

Distributed Systems Auditability, within cryptocurrency, options trading, and financial derivatives, necessitates a layered architectural approach to provenance tracking. This involves establishing immutable logs of all state transitions and transactional data across the entire system, encompassing exchanges, clearinghouses, and underlying blockchain infrastructure. Effective architecture prioritizes modularity, enabling independent verification of each component’s integrity and facilitating forensic analysis following anomalous events. The design must account for both on-chain and off-chain activities, bridging the gap between transparent blockchain records and potentially opaque centralized systems.
